Drive-Thru Gourmet: Arby’s latest really puts the ‘B’ in ‘BLT’
This week I reached out for a Triple Thick Brown Sugar Bacon BLT, new for a limited time only at Arby’s, with 3,300 restaurants across, up and down the U.S.
Sometimes all you have to do is read the menu to know, “I gotta try that.” “Triple,” “thick,” “brown sugar,” “bacon”: Stop me when you hear something you’re not craving. Usually I say that if it takes six words to name it, don’t order it. But these are unusual times.
Here’s the Triple Thick Brown Sugar Bacon BLT breakdown: four extra-heavy pieces of bacon, leaf lettuce, tomatoes and mayo on a sweet brioche bun.
Total calories: 800. Fat grams: 57. Sodium: 1,260 mg. Carbs: 57 g. Dietary fiber: 3 g. Protein: 15 g. Manufacturer’s suggested retail price: $4.99.
Those numbers are a little high across the board, especially the calories and fat grams. But you know my feelings about mayonnaise: just say “no.” Hold the mayo, and this bacon dreamwich drops to 690 calories and 45 fat grams.
The bacon really is thicker than you’d expect from a chain emporium. Each slice is about 1/4 inch thick, so add ’em up and you’re getting about a 1-inch slab of bacon. We’re talking pork belly here.
The bacon is hand-sprinkled with brown sugar and baked — the best way to cook bacon — in each Arby’s restaurant. Baking keeps bacon true to form, renders the fat and really pops the brown sugar, producing super-sweet and flavorful hunks of meaty bacon.
The buttery-sweet brioche bun puts the sugar rush over the top. The only thing missing is hot fudge sauce as a condiment. Hey Arby’s, if that’s next, I want credit.
If you’re one of those (or, everybody) who never gets enough “B” in your BLT, this might be the pot of bacon at the end of your rainbow.
The BLT with something extra is one of four new Triple Thick Brown Sugar Bacon sandwiches at Arby’s. The others are Roast Beef, Turkey and the “Half Pound Club.”
